Map 6, so its just boost. Added .5 at 5500, 1.8 PSI at 6000 rpm and up.
Not sure what happened to my LC but it now launches on 2 PSI boost. (got a tune update last week) Last year i was running winter dragy 1.82, 1.83s and now 1.77, 1.78s 60 foots.
Fuel is mix of E0 and E85, around E25 and a little Lucas. I need to measure the E content if i can get some gas out. I was right at the E max as i had 2 LCs bog which happens to me in the E25, E30 range.

Assuming GT rear wheel drive, 18° temperature doesn't seem like ideal conditions for traction. Never get your best run on full tank or with a passenger, but looking at the 40 - 60 mph you may want to submit a log to Terry. Did you regap or change plugs? What octane are you running? I'm a GT2 AWD and with a plug change..Densos .024 (soon to be .022 when I get WMI installed) with flex fuel kit 93 pump and E30 along with a good e-brake launch will get 4 flat to mid 4's on a bad run. Read up on the threads dealing with launching, check your logs with Terry@BMS and change plugs if you haven't already. Don't expect too much on frozen tires. Good luck

I expect cooler temps and 1/4 tank of fuel should help. I also had a lot of wheel spin in 1st and into 2nd. I may also try boost by gear when I get a chance and see if limiting wheel spin in 1st helps.
 
On traction limited RWD cars lowering boost in 1st gear can often help with the launch.
